Global Trends in Cloud Migration Infrastructure

The shift from public-only cloud environments to hybrid, multi-cloud, and bare-metal edge deployments has transformed data center demands. Modern enterprises face rising public egress costs and compliance restrictions on public multi-tenant clouds. Consequently, organizations are migrating back to localized cloud clusters or dedicated on-premises infrastructure. This architectural transition has created a significant demand for wholesale cloud migration services, high-performance hardware, and customized rackmount configurations.

1. Computational Demands of LLMs and DeepSeek Architecture

The rise of large language models (LLMs) and local AI model deployment (such as DeepSeek) has reshaped standard enterprise workload requirements. Standard 1U and 2U rack servers must deliver high computing density and efficient thermal performance to support intense parallel workloads. As organizations migrate data-intensive AI models away from public clouds to maintain control over proprietary data, local high-density GPU nodes become a foundational element of their infrastructure strategy.

2. Minimizing Egress Costs and Latency Bottlenecks

Organizations transitioning petabyte-scale workloads quickly discover that network bandwidth and egress fees pose major roadblocks. Deploying high-density server configurations directly in local colocation facilities allows operators to build dedicated staging systems. These local nodes serve as landing zones to process, clean, and pre-aggregate data before migrating critical segments, resulting in significant savings on transit costs.

How does server hardware optimization reduce overall cloud migration risk?
During large-scale data migrations, virtualization layers require consistent CPU access, low memory latency, and rapid disk write speeds. Custom-configured servers minimize disk-write queues, reduce network packet loss, and eliminate CPU throttling. By optimizing hardware profiles for the primary virtualization platform, companies avoid unexpected performance drops and ensure consistent system operations.
